Tragic Fire at South Korean Lithium Battery Plant Claims 21 Lives

By | June 24, 2024

In a tragic incident that has shocked the world, at least 21 people have lost their lives in a devastating fire at a lithium battery plant in South Korea. The news broke on Twitter through a tweet by The General (@GeneralMCNews) on June 24, 2024.

The incident has once again brought the spotlight on the safety measures in place at industrial facilities, especially those dealing with hazardous materials like lithium batteries. The exact cause of the fire is still under investigation, but early reports suggest that it may have been sparked by a malfunction in the production process.
